CHAPTER 5<br />

DENYING THE HOLOCAUST<br />

A NEO-NAZI MYTHOLOGY<br />

FOR TWO MILLENNIA SCURRILOUS MYTHS about Jews abounded in<br />

Christian lands. We have seen how the medieval Christian myth of the Jew as<br />

Satan’s agent conspiring to destroy Christendom helped spawn the modern<br />

nationalist myth of a Jewish cabal plotting to rule the planet. This myth and<br />

others about Jews, including their racial inferiority, were widely believed by<br />

many people and unashamedly propagated by members of the cultural elite—<br />

all this in a scientific age that had experienced the critical spirit of the Enlightenment.<br />

The Nazis employed these myths to justify their war against the Jews:<br />

They were cleansing Europe of parasitical subhumans who threatened the fatherland.<br />

The zeal and brutality displayed by both the SS and ordinary Germans<br />

involved in the extermination process attest to the immense impact these<br />

myths had on people’s thinking.<br />

The systematic slaughter of two-thirds of the Jewish population of Europe<br />

shamed many people and awakened them to the evilness and danger of<br />

anti-Jewish myths. It also spurred a growing Christian-Jewish dialogue that<br />

has fostered greater understanding and tolerance. As a result, the propagation<br />

of old myths about Jews has greatly abated in Western lands, at least in respectable<br />

circles. Nevertheless, antisemitism still has the capacity to ignite<br />

people’s meanest feelings and distort thinking, as in the disturbing phenomenon<br />

of Holocaust denial.
